Merge branch 'master' of https://github.com/rafael2k/darkice
This commit is contained in:
commit
8f52426a7e
|
@ -164,7 +164,7 @@ FaacEncoder :: write ( const void * buf,
|
||||||
if ( converter ) {
|
if ( converter ) {
|
||||||
unsigned int converted;
|
unsigned int converted;
|
||||||
#ifdef HAVE_SRC_LIB
|
#ifdef HAVE_SRC_LIB
|
||||||
src_short_to_float_array ((short *) b, converterData.data_in, samples);
|
src_short_to_float_array ((short *) b, (float *) converterData.data_in, samples);
|
||||||
converterData.input_frames = nSamples;
|
converterData.input_frames = nSamples;
|
||||||
converterData.data_out = resampledOffset + (resampledOffsetSize * channels);
|
converterData.data_out = resampledOffset + (resampledOffsetSize * channels);
|
||||||
int srcError = src_process (converter, &converterData);
|
int srcError = src_process (converter, &converterData);
|
||||||
|
|
|
@ -403,7 +403,7 @@ OpusLibEncoder :: write ( const void * buf,
|
||||||
#ifdef HAVE_SRC_LIB
|
#ifdef HAVE_SRC_LIB
|
||||||
(void)inCount;
|
(void)inCount;
|
||||||
converterData.input_frames = processed;
|
converterData.input_frames = processed;
|
||||||
src_short_to_float_array (shortBuffer, converterData.data_in, totalSamples);
|
src_short_to_float_array (shortBuffer, (float *) converterData.data_in, totalSamples);
|
||||||
int srcError = src_process (converter, &converterData);
|
int srcError = src_process (converter, &converterData);
|
||||||
if (srcError)
|
if (srcError)
|
||||||
throw Exception (__FILE__, __LINE__, "libsamplerate error: ", src_strerror (srcError));
|
throw Exception (__FILE__, __LINE__, "libsamplerate error: ", src_strerror (srcError));
|
||||||
|
|
|
@ -337,7 +337,7 @@ VorbisLibEncoder :: write ( const void * buf,
|
||||||
int converted;
|
int converted;
|
||||||
#ifdef HAVE_SRC_LIB
|
#ifdef HAVE_SRC_LIB
|
||||||
converterData.input_frames = nSamples;
|
converterData.input_frames = nSamples;
|
||||||
src_short_to_float_array (shortBuffer, converterData.data_in, totalSamples);
|
src_short_to_float_array (shortBuffer, (float *) converterData.data_in, totalSamples);
|
||||||
int srcError = src_process (converter, &converterData);
|
int srcError = src_process (converter, &converterData);
|
||||||
if (srcError)
|
if (srcError)
|
||||||
throw Exception (__FILE__, __LINE__, "libsamplerate error: ", src_strerror (srcError));
|
throw Exception (__FILE__, __LINE__, "libsamplerate error: ", src_strerror (srcError));
|
||||||
|
|
|
@ -155,7 +155,7 @@ aacPlusEncoder :: write ( const void * buf,
|
||||||
if ( converter ) {
|
if ( converter ) {
|
||||||
unsigned int converted;
|
unsigned int converted;
|
||||||
#ifdef HAVE_SRC_LIB
|
#ifdef HAVE_SRC_LIB
|
||||||
src_short_to_float_array ((short *) b, converterData.data_in, samples);
|
src_short_to_float_array ((short *) b, (float *) converterData.data_in, samples);
|
||||||
converterData.input_frames = nSamples;
|
converterData.input_frames = nSamples;
|
||||||
converterData.data_out = resampledOffset + (resampledOffsetSize * channels);
|
converterData.data_out = resampledOffset + (resampledOffsetSize * channels);
|
||||||
int srcError = src_process (converter, &converterData);
|
int srcError = src_process (converter, &converterData);
|
||||||
|
|
Loading…
Reference in New Issue